starting problems

93 sonata, been around this car fior a year, 150K+ miles. fiancee recently gave it to my 16 year old daughter as first car. has had random starting issues where when turning key to start, there is nothing. no cranking, absolutely nothing. has done this VERY randomly. after 3-4 tries, it always starts as normally. fiancee said ignition switch was replaced a couple years ago, not sure why. regardless, daughter left lights on at school the other day, drained battery. i have charged it, and attempted jumping, but it is same symptoms as before, absolutely NOTHING, no starter cranking, all the lights and everything work, i hear a click coming from passenger kickpanel? when key goes to start position, but thats ALL. cheked fuses inside car and relays by battery. only fusible links on battery cable are for alt and fan. is there another somewhere? ANY ideas would be greatly appreciated. car is stuck at the high school for 5 days now, until i can get it started or pull it home to work on it easier.
